Bankruptcy Judge Martin Glenn largely approved the final fee requests for the professionals working on Residential Capital LLC 's bankruptcy case, which totaled nearly $400 million, Dow Jones Daily Bankruptcy Review reported today. Judge Glenn made some small subtractions from the fee requests and said that he would rule later on the application of Morrison Cohen LLP, the law firm representing ResCap's independent directors. ResCap's liquidating trust had objected to nearly $1 million of Morrison Cohen's request for $4.3 million in fees and expenses, saying that among other things that the firm held too many unnecessary meetings.
